Transaction dfde799590311820765c1a7d3271b886e1321914867d17d23d06835acfb0bb59
1 Input
1 Output
-
dfde799590311820765c1a7d3271b886e1321914867d17d23d06835acfb0bb59:0
- value
- 3952479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e95a39363a9da25f99d97c63cd7ea2e26dcdb3a OP_EQUAL
- address
- 3DELKp4HYdfdpK8mjBd5wq85as36Pc3D4J